Background: Why is Kempegowda International Airport Expanding?
Since its inauguration in 2008, Kempegowda International Airport has consistently ranked among India’s fastest-growing airports. With passenger traffic projected to surpass 50 million annually by 2025, the need for expanded infrastructure has become urgent. The current expansion includes a second terminal, new runways, improved cargo facilities, and enhanced connectivity to the city center. These developments are not just about improving passenger experience; they are set to transform the airport into a key economic engine for the region.

Impact on Residential Property: Boon or Bane?
One of the primary impacts of airport expansion is on residential real estate in adjacent areas such as Devanahalli, Hebbal, Yelahanka, and Hennur. Historically, proximity to major infrastructure has boosted property values, and Bangalore is no exception.
1. Surge in Demand
With improved connectivity and the promise of job opportunities around the airport, these neighborhoods are seeing a surge in demand for both rental and owned properties. Developers are launching new projects catering to a range of budgets, from affordable apartments to luxury villas.
2. Price Appreciation
Property prices in Devanahalli and surrounding localities have already witnessed an upward trajectory. According to recent market reports, land rates within a 10-15 km radius of the airport have increased by up to 30% in the last three years. Analysts expect this trend to continue as the expansion nears completion.
3. Rental Yields
For investors, the area promises attractive rental yields. With more professionals moving closer to the airport for work, the demand for rental accommodations is likely to grow, further boosting returns for property owners.
Commercial Real Estate: The Next Growth Node
The airport expansion is also catalyzing the commercial real estate sector. The zones around the airport are emerging as hotspots for office spaces, business parks, retail outlets, and hospitality ventures.
1. Office and Business Hubs
Several multinational companies and start-ups are eyeing the vicinity of the airport for setting up offices, given its strategic location for both domestic and international connectivity. The announcement of upcoming business parks and Special Economic Zones (SEZs) is expected to generate thousands of new jobs, further fueling demand for residential and commercial spaces.
2. Hospitality and Retail Boom
Hotels, serviced apartments, and retail complexes are mushrooming around the airport to cater to business travelers and tourists. This boom is not only enhancing the region’s commercial appeal but also creating new investment opportunities for property buyers and developers alike.
Infrastructure Upgrades: Enhancing Accessibility
One of the most significant outcomes of the airport expansion is the spurt in infrastructure development. The upcoming Metro Rail link, improved highways, and flyovers are set to drastically reduce travel time from the city center to the airport. This enhanced accessibility is making the northern corridor of Bangalore more attractive for both homebuyers and businesses, further pushing up property prices.
